Jim Lenc called this 23-pound gobbler, with an 11-inch beard, from the timber in Woodford County.

“It came in completely silent, strutting at about 80 yards out, until it hit my two hen and one tom decoy spread,’’ he emailed.

He added, “Same turkey burnt “Musky Ed’’ Potocki during first season with a silent entry at same spot.’’
